Barangay Ginebra and Meralco Secure Key Wins to Boost PBA Philippine Cup Playoff Hopes

Macario Yambao

Barangay Ginebra and Meralco asserted their dominance in separate matches on Thursday at the Ynares Center in Antipolo City, strengthening their bids for the quarterfinals in the PBA Philippine Cup.

In the first game, Barangay Ginebra overcame Blackwater with a convincing 103-85 victory. The Gin Kings broke away during the second quarter, outscoring Blackwater 40-20 to establish a commanding 63-42 halftime lead. Ginebra maintained their momentum in the second half, extending their largest lead to 98-71 with under five minutes remaining in the fourth quarter. Despite an 8-0 run from the Blackwater Bossing, Ginebra's cushion remained unassailable.

RJ Abarrientos paced Ginebra with 15 points, supported by Stephen Holt and Jeremiah Gray who each contributed 12 points. Jayson David and Troy Rosario added 11 and 10 points respectively, helping the team improve to a 4-4 record.

For Blackwater, Dalph Panopio led the scoring with 22 points, while Sedrick Barefield and Abu Tratter added 17 and 12 points respectively. The loss extended Blackwater's losing streak to eight games following their season-opening win.

Earlier in the day, Meralco secured a commanding 120-87 victory over Terrafirma to also advance to a 4-4 standing. CJ Cansino led the Bolts with 20 points, alongside Chris Banchero and Chris Newsome who scored 13 and 12 points respectively. Bong Quinto and Raymond Almazan each chipped in 11 points.

Despite a strong individual effort from Mark Nonoy, who scored 22 points, Terrafirma struggled to keep pace, with Paolo Hernandez and Louie Sangalang adding 18 and 13 points respectively. The loss dropped Terrafirma to 1-8, eliminating them from playoff contention.

With these results, Barangay Ginebra and Meralco are tied for seventh place in the standings, while Blackwater and Terrafirma's chances of advancing have effectively ended.
